Stairway To Heaven
5.0% Premium Bitter / Strong Bitter / ESB
Stairway to Heaven Gold Medal Ale. A.B.V. 5.0%. Colour. Pale. Nose. Distinctive hoppy aroma. Taste. Smooth easy drinking beer, but be careful of it's strength. Hops. Fuggles & Goldings with late copper hops added. Malt. Pale.
